WebNov 11, 2024 · A panic room is an enclosed space designed to keep your family safe in the event of a home invasion or burglary. It’s typically built within the walls of a residence and can be accessed through a secret door or hidden passage. A panic room can be accessed from inside your home or from an external area, such as the garage or backyard. WebJan 23, 2024 · The door is the weakest point of a room, so you will have to use thick-gauge metal like steel, but with a wooden exterior as camouflage. It should be secured with chain locks and barrel bolts. It should be inward-opening and have a horizontal metal bar. The hinges and bolts should not be accessible from outside.
